Vault APY stands for Annual Percentage Yield, specifically in relation to assets held in a vault. It represents the amount of interest earned on investments or deposits within a vault over one year.Vaults are investment vehicles that can pool funds from multiple investors. They typically deploy strategies like lending, yield farming, or liquidity provision to generate returns. The APY reflects the potential yield earned from these activities, taking into account factors such as compounding interest.The APY can fluctuate based on market conditions, underlying asset performance, and user participation. This can lead to varying rates between different vaults even for similar assets. Investors use Vault APY to assess the profitability of their investments, compare different vaults, and make informed decisions. A higher APY usually indicates a more attractive investment opportunity, but it often comes with higher risk. Always consider the trade-off between potential reward and risk when evaluating these yields.
